NM =Not Measured <br /> Analytical: MTBE=methyl tertiary-butyl ether NS=Not Sampled <br /> Unit Conversions: pg/L:micrograms per liter=parts per billion(ppb) <br /> 4.0 MONITORING WELL DESTRUCTION AND INSTALLATION PROCEDURES <br /> This section includes a description of the site preparation, drilling procedures, monitoring well <br />' destruction, monitoring well installation, surveying, development, and sampling procedures, and the <br /> laboratory analytical methodology. <br /> 4.1 SITE PREPARATION <br /> Condor received well destruction and drilling permits from the SJCEHD for destruction of the on-site <br /> monitoring wells and installation of the proposed groundwater monitoring wells prior to initiating any <br /> fieldwork. The proposed monitoring well locations were marked with white paint and USA was notified <br /> 72 hours in advance of the fieldwork to locate and identify underground utilities in and near the work <br /> area. However, because the monitoring well locations were on private property, some utilities contacted <br />' by USA did not mark their lines past property boundaries and on to the site. Cruz Brothers conducted on- <br /> site underground utility line location and identificdtion services on October 17, 2003. The SJCEHD was <br /> notified of the fieldwork schedule 72 hours in advance. <br /> 1 <br /> �� CONDOR <br />
